From "You and Your Research" by Richard Hamming :

http://www.dgp.toronto.edu/~anab/grad/hamming.html

    I started asking, "What are the important problems
    of your field?"  And after a week or so,  "What
    important problems are you working on?" And after
    some more time I came in one day and said, "If what
    you are doing is not important, and if you don't
    think it is going to lead to something important,
    why are you at Bell Labs working on it?"

    I wasn't welcomed after that.
It doesn't necessarily apply, because that was research he was talking about, not "making money" or even"making a living."
